Divemaster Internship

Do you want to become a professional Scuba Diver for Free?

Our PADI Divemaster Internship allows you to receive free training in return for work experience. Get trained and certified as a professional PADI Divemaster, without the expense! Narima Diving are proud to be affiliated with IDC-Lanta (professional level scuba diving training), for more information on Divemaster Internships read below or click here.

Add to your training with real-life, hands-on experience. We believe this is the best grounding you can get if you’d like to take your diving career to the next step. You will be qualified to guide certified divers, conduct PADI Scuba Reviews and assist PADI Instructors in some of their tasks. This qualification allows you to make money from scuba diving. Earn a living, doing what you love! Become a professional member of PADI, the world’s biggest dive educator, and you’ll be able to work in the dive industry in PADI dive centres and resorts around the world.

How long is the programme?

The Divemaster Course itself can be completed in 2-6 weeks, although if you have more time, it is a more relaxed environment! The time it takes is very dependent on the amount of experience and number of logged dives you already have, as well as how hard you are prepared to work, as there is quite a lot of self-study involved!

You must then commit to working as a PADI Divemaster with Narima Diving for a further 45 working days (this is days you go out on the boat and work as a Divemaster) – so you need to have a certain amount of flexibility in your travel commitments. We would recommend 3-6 months as a good period of time to allocate to this project.

We hope that after you complete your training programme, you will continue to work as a paid professional PADI Divemaster with us.


How much will it cost?

We provide all your training, manuals, equipment rental and up to 40 dives for free. In return, you must agree to work for us for a further 45 days after your certification as a PADI Divemaster is complete. You will gain invaluable work experience during this time, which will help you find your next job.

You must have enough money to cover your living costs during the programme.

Each Divemaster course we offer is tailor-made to suit your level of experience and we work with you to ensure that by the end of the dive course, you have a solid grounding in all the areas of knowledge development as well as some real work/ practical experience that you can add to your CV when applying for future jobs within the dive industry.

We currently accept 2 people per season onto the Divemaster Internship programme. If you are not accepted onto the Internship programme, you may still pay to do your Divemaster course with us.


When can I start?

The best time of year to start a Divemaster Inernship with us is from October to January since this is our high season (from October to mid-May). This means the boats are out daily, there will be a variety of courses for you to assist on and will give you enough time to complete both the practical and theoretical sections of the course.


What equipment do I need?

To start the Divemaster Internship, you don’t need any equipment. However, by the time you complete your Divemaster training, you should have a full set. In order to work as a Divemaster, most dive centres would expect you to have your own equipment.

Who can apply?

If you’re aged 18+ and have a 20+ logged dives, have already completed the PADI Advanced Open Water and Rescue Diver courses (or equivalent), are in general good health and fitness, you should be eligible to become a fully certified Divemaster. You must also have an up-to-date (within 2 years) CPR certification or Emergency First Responder qualification.
